Block 624,773
Block Hash
8424f4b0fb55e3420e9e21512d7269852acf52c409f4e14332c9cd744042d04a
Previous Block Hash
267705cac40a28318c7c4e5849f66e7fab5c368ad5e8402e93d08a21a32b9221
Mined
Transactions
2
Difficulty
25.70 M
Size
398 bytes
Transactions (2)
1 input, 1 output
10,000.00226
PEPE
1 input, 2 outputs
92,513.11554
PEPE